Medical Transport Boxes Market Analysis
The Medical Transport Boxes Market size is estimated at USD 0.73 billion in 2025, and is expected to reach USD 1.03 billion by 2030, at a CAGR of 6.88% during the forecast period (2025-2030).
Factors such as an increase in the burden of chronic diseases and a rise in organ transplantation coupled with increasing adoption of cold storage infrastructure in transporting organs and blood components are expected to drive the market. For instance, according to a January 2025 update from the United Network for Organ Sharing (UNOS), the United States witnessed a surge in organ transplants, jumping to 48,149 in 2024 from 31,121 in 2023. This significant increase in the volume of transplants underscores the critical demand for efficient and reliable medical transport solutions, such as organ transport boxes, to ensure the safe and timely delivery of organs for transplantation.
Furthermore, the transportation and donation of blood components in resource-limited settings increase the utilization of medical transport boxes, which is likely to fuel the market growth over the forecast period. For instance, in May 2023, the Indian Council of Medical Research (ICMR), Union Health Ministry conducted a trial run of blood bag delivery by drones under its iDrone initiative. The inaugural trial flight carried 10 units of whole blood samples from GIMS and LHMC. ICMR was using drone services for healthcare purposes and successfully conducted the delivery of medical supplies, vaccines, and medicines in remote areas of Manipur and Nagaland. Thus, such initiatives are expected to raise the adoption of medical transport boxes to carry blood products, which is thereby expected to propel the market growth over the forecast period.
Furthermore, the presence of key players and their strategic product launches are expected to bolster market growth. For instance, in November 2024, Secop GmbH unveiled a new range of ultra-low-temperature compressors tailored for medical use. These reliable cooling systems are intended for hospitals and laboratories, guaranteeing the secure storage of vials and mRNA vaccines. Hence, owing to the strategic launch of advanced products, the demand for medical transport boxes is likely to rise, leading to segment growth over the forecast period.
Thus, owing to the increase in organ donation and the increase in strategic activities by the key players, the studied market is expected to witness significant growth over the forecast period. However, the high cost of medical transport boxes is likely to hinder the market growth over the forecast period.
Medical Transport Boxes Market Trends
Vaccine Segment are Expected to Witness a Positive Growth Over the Forecast Period
Vaccines hold a significant role in treating infections. Most vaccines are recommended to be stored between 2° to 8°C, which is the recommended refrigerator temperature. Further, the live varicella (chickenpox) and Zostavax (shingles) vaccines must be stored frozen between -50° to -15°C. Due to the strict storage conditions of vaccines, medical transport boxes are widely used to transport the vaccines across the globe. Factors such as an increase in infectious diseases, a rise in the transportation of vaccines from one country or region to another, and an increase in government initiatives to support vaccine availabilities are expected to drive the market growth over the forecast period. For instance, as per the February 2025 update from National Notifiable Diseases Surveillance System, 13,451 notifications of laboratory-confirmed influenza cases as of February 3, 2025, in Australia. This significant number highlights the growing demand for vaccines, which are transported via various medical transport solutions, such as refrigerators and cold storage, to ensure the safe and secure handling of vaccines. These transport boxes play a critical role in maintaining the vaccine’s integrity during transit, which is essential for accurate laboratory testing and timely reporting. Thus, the high prevalence of flu prevalence is likely to increase the adoption of medical transport boxes, thereby driving the segment growth over the forecast period.
Furthermore, an increase in government initiatives to support and conduct vaccine drives for various infectious diseases is expected to bolster the segment growth over the study period. For instance, according to the July 2023 update by UNICEF, 12 countries across different regions in Africa are set to receive 18 million doses of the first-ever malaria vaccine over the next two years. The products are likely to be received by countries such as Ghana, Kenya, and Malawi owing to the implementation of the Malaria Vaccine Implementation Programme. Hence, such vaccine drives in an economically weaker region will require a safe transport of vaccines, which is expected to adopt medical transport boxes, contributing to the segment growth over the forecast period.
Thus, owing to the increase in infectious diseases and the rise in implementation of vaccination drives by the government, the studied segment is expected to witness significant growth over the forecast period.
North America is Expected to Witness a Significant Growth Over the Forecast Period
North America is expected to witness significant market growth owing to better healthcare infrastructure, an increase in blood donation, a rise in organ transplantation, and the presence of major industry players. For instance, as reported in the July 2024 update by the Canadian Institute for Health Information, Canada recorded a total of 3,428 organ transplants in 2023. The significant number of organ transplants performed in Canada highlights the growing demand for efficient organ transportation solutions. This trend is expected to drive the adoption of medical transport boxes, thereby contributing to the expansion of the North American market during the forecast period.
Furthermore, the presence of key players and their strategic expansions and product distributions are expected to augment the market growth in the North American region. For instance, in August 2023, Paragonix Technologies, a prominent player in the organ transplant industry, introduced an innovative donor organ courier service in collaboration with the Nationwide Organ Recovery Transport Alliance (NORA). This strategic initiative marks a significant advancement in organ transplantation logistics by leveraging cutting-edge preservation technology. The service offers a cost-efficient alternative and is likely to utilize advanced medical transport boxes to traditional private charters by utilizing commercial air transportation for the sensitive transfer of donor organs, thereby driving the market growth in the region.
Thus, due to increased organ transplantation procedures and strategic acquisitions, North America is expected to witness significant growth over the forecast period.
